Understanding Mold Growth in HVAC Systems

Mold thrives in moist, dark environments. Your HVAC system, if not properly maintained, can become a breeding ground. Here’s why Laguna Hills homeowners should care: - Humidity levels can exceed 60% in Laguna Hills, especially during summer. - Mold can grow within 24-48 hours in the right conditions. - It poses serious health risks, including respiratory issues.

Signs of Mold in Your HVAC System

Spotting mold early can save you time and money. Look for these signs: 1. Musty odors when the HVAC system runs. 2. Visible mold on vents or air filters. 3. Increased allergy symptoms among family members. 4. Excess moisture around HVAC components.

Steps to Detect Mold in Your HVAC System

Detecting mold involves thorough checking. Follow these steps to ensure your HVAC system is clean: 1. Inspect vents and ductwork for visible mold. 2. Check air filters regularly for discoloration. 3. Monitor humidity levels using a hygrometer. 4. Schedule professional air quality testing.

DIY Tips to Reduce Mold Growth

While professional cleaning is crucial, you can take action at home. Here are some DIY tips: - Use a dehumidifier to lower humidity levels. - Ensure proper ventilation in bathrooms and kitchens. - Clean and replace air filters every 1-3 months. - Regularly check for leaks around windows and pipes.
